| Covington, VA (Oct. 3, 2024) - Local author Sarah Burnette will hold a signing and book talk for her book, “The Warrior & Armor Bearer”, at the Alleghany Highlands Regional Library. The event will take place on Saturday, October 12th at 11:00 am in the upstairs Community Room.
The book chronicles the last chance opportunity for a “warrior” father and his only child “armor bearer” to find forgiveness, healing and a true relationship in the unlikely confines of a room with chairs of institution blue, AKA the Chemo Room. It is a raw and unedited account of some of life’s greatest lessons as learned through the eyes of both the living and the dying.
Burnette, a Clifton Forge native, is a wife, mother of five children, and nana of nine grandchildren. She is employed as a Deputy Commissioner of Revenue in Alleghany County. Burnette describes herself as a red-headed, Jesus loving, crazy cat lady who is addicted to coffee. Copies of “The Warrior & Armor Bearer” will be available for purchase the day of the event for $20 each or 2 for $35.
